Suzuki Power Window Wiring Diagram - Console Switch, Sub Switches & Motors

Wiring diagram for power window system showing console and sub-switches, front and rear window motors, and color-coded circuits.

This document is a power window system wiring diagram scanned from a factory-style service manual. It shows the complete power window circuit: a master POWER WINDOW SWITCH mounted in the console, three POWER WINDOW SUB SWITCHes (front RH, rear LH, rear RH), and four power window motors (front RH, rear LH, rear RH shown; front LH implied via console switch). The diagram traces wire colors — Bl/W (blue/white) power feed, G/B, R/B, Y, R, G/W, R/W, Br, and Br/B ground — through numbered connectors including E38/G05, G01/L01, L04 and L03 junction connectors (J/C), L08/J34, J35/J41, L25/J36, J33/J42, E51/J05, J06/J07, J09/J10, J11, J02/J03, J08, J23/J24, J31/J32, J15, J20, J22, and J14. Two connector variant blocks are labeled '#1 <CAMI·4WD>' and '#2 <CAMI·4WD>', indicating alternate connector pinouts for CAMI-built 4WD vehicles. Each sub switch shows ON/OFF contact positions for UP and DOWN operation. A reader can use this diagram to trace power window circuits, identify connector pin numbers and wire colors for diagnosing inoperative windows, and locate ground points (Br/B to chassis ground).

Frequently asked questions

What wire color is the main power feed for the power window circuit?
The main feed shown running across the top of the diagram and to the console switch is Bl/W (blue/white).
Which connectors are used for the front right power window motor?
The front RH power window sub switch is connector J11, feeding through J02/J03 (pins 2 and 1, wires Y and R) to connector J08 at the front RH power window motor.
What does the <CAMI·4WD> notation mean on this diagram?
The diagram shows two alternate connector blocks labeled '#1 <CAMI·4WD>' (connectors L08/J34 and J35/J41) and '#2 <CAMI·4WD>' (connectors L25/J36 and J33/J42), indicating different connector pinouts used on CAMI-built 4WD vehicles.
How are the rear power window motors wired?
The rear LH motor connects through connector J22 (pins 2 and 1) with Y and R wires from the rear LH sub switch (J20); the rear RH motor connects through J14 (pins 2 and 1) with Y and R wires from the rear RH sub switch (J15).
Where does the power window circuit ground?
Ground wires are Br and Br/B, routed through junction connector L03 and connector G05/E38 to a chassis ground symbol at the bottom of the diagram.
